Forrest Gump: This is on my top 3 favorite movies, so I have little to complain about. The one and only thing I have to complain about this movie is Jenny. Each time I watch this movie, I hate Jenny just a little bit more. She doesn't deserve Forrest Gump and I really hate how she just comes in and out of his life as she pleases. I don't care that she wrote him a lot of letters that got delievered to him all at once when he was in the hospital trying to give Lt. Dan ice cream. She turns down his sweet proposal, sneaks into his room at night, bounces before he wakes up and leaves him all alone. Then she has a child, apparently has AIDS (even though it doesn't say it in the movie, it hints at it) and then proposes to sweet Forrest after she finds out she is sick with a virus the doctors don't know. I connected the dots the other day and realized that if she has AIDS, she gave it to Forrest. Ugh. I hate her. Don't even get me started when she is dying in bed and asks Forrest if he was scared in 'Nam and he goes through all the beautiful things of his life and she says, "I wish I could have been there with you." and sweet, loving Forrest says, "You were." MAKES ME CRY EVERY TIME. Then that is followed by the saddest scene in any movie. When he is talking to her grave. I have to stop talking before I cry.
